With a local historian as your guide, explore the Historic District of New Market, Virginia with its more than 40 historic buildings encompassing colonial, federal, antebellum, and Victorian homes.  Not only will we tell you when a house was built, but we will also share the story of the people who once lived here: how Anna Maria outwitted the Yankees, Dr. Henkel's unique medical methods, how Uncle Billy got his wooden leg, and how Jessie Rupert saved the town from burning. The entire town of New Market is listed on The National Register of Historic Places. Available throughout the year by appointment or weekly in the spring-fall.
